Scranton snow in 2017-18
Scranton recorded 52.1 inches of snow in 2017-18, against a 1991-2020 normal of 45.1 inches. Measurable snow, at 0.1 inch or more, fell on 39 days at Wilkes Barre Scranton International Airport, and the largest single fall was 8.5 inches on Mar 2, 2018.

The readings come from Wilkes Barre Scranton International Airport, a GHCN-Daily station whose record begins in 1949. Station observations from GHCN-Daily, with a 1 to 3 day lag and quality checks.
